WebbFor an Extremely Hazardous Substance (EHS), the reporting threshold (or Threshold Planning Quantity referred to as the TPQ) will be 10, 100 or 500 pounds. If your facility uses or stores more than the reporting threshold, then that substance must be included in your annual Tier II report. WebbGuidance for Tier II Reporting of Lead Acid Batteries Below is a summary the preferred method to report lead acid batteries. Lead acid batteries are considered a mixture containing sulfuric acid, an extremely hazardous substance (EHS), and other non-EHS hazardous chemicals such as lead, lead oxide and lead sulfate.
